In 2000, we were parked two months on the Oregon coasta month 
volunteering at Fort Stevens State Park near Astoria, followed by a 
month at Honeyman State Park, near Florence OR.  We were then 
full-timing in a 1992 Excella 29-footer that had been refinished by the 
Ruth family (P&S Trailer Service) in Helena OH earlier.

In 2001, we were on the Oregon coast volunteering againtwo months at 
Fort Stevens and a month at Honeyman.  This time our full-timing home 
was a new 2001 Excella 31-footer, which we still have.

We experienced no problems or bad effects from exposure to ocean air.

Incidentally, who did the refinishing on your trailer?  If it was done 
in Oregon or near the coast, the refinishers might have some comment on 
the effects of the Oregon coast ocean air.
